Output e6095675cfcceeb58b89e6da6bbe3b3c2d63c06c4f509bc41a2df1f014e92a9c:1

value
2179623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d14b21652023413d864f41cfa3d683b15da975bd OP_EQUAL
address
3Lmf9nrfzQX2QXDR4LBFPtiR7whKgQkGkZ
transaction
e6095675cfcceeb58b89e6da6bbe3b3c2d63c06c4f509bc41a2df1f014e92a9c
confirmations
343611
spent
true